My partners Aunt has lived at Heathlands for several years. She was living with complex needs, unable to care for herself or communicate her needs effectively. Everytime we visited it was clear how well she was looked after. Not only her physical but her emotional needs were clearly well met. She
was always clean and well looked after and her response to the care team and nurses showed she was comfortable in their care. The nurses and care team were always welcoming to us as visitors. Infact the entire team. Even their very kind maintaince man who I met on a few occasions was always polite and spoke of her fondly having clearly spent time chatting to her when maintaining her bedroom etc. The home itself is clean and well kept. The corridors are 'dementia friendly' with wall art creating a street scene. They have appropriate equipment such as tilt and space chairs and equipment to support her head and limbs following a stroke, enabling her to comfortably into communal areas.

Have been happy with HCC. The food is excellent, healthy and varied. The staff are caring and kind and keep family members informed about any medical or personal issues. If there are any queries or concerns, these are discussed and acted upon - and doctors or nurses are called upon, if
necessary.
Music and games together with live musicians are encouraged and all the residents enjoy and look forward to these regular activities. Arts and crafts are also part of the day and enjoyed, together with bingo and some ball games are played too. On sunny days the residents are taken into the garden.
Regular daily cleaning takes place with smiling cleaners and care to hygiene is very important and adhered to. The head of maintenance is always on hand assisting and helping - and always chats to all the residents and family members.
Reception/adiminstrator is always friendly and very helpful in all matters helping HCC to run smoothly and efficiently.
